How do you fin x using the equation y=1 .5 x

Answer: Possible answers:

- Isolating the varible

- Dividing both sides of the equation by 1.5

- x = \displaystyle \frac{y}{1.5}

Step-by-step explanation:

    In this case, "finding x" will be setting the equation equal to x. In other words, we will isolate the variable x.

    To do this, we will divide both sides of the equation by 1.5. Sine the x is being multiplied by 1.5, the inverse operation of multiplication is division.

         y = 1.5x

         \frac{y}{1.5} = \frac{1.5x}{1.5}

         \frac{y}{1.5} = 1x

         \frac{y}{1.5} = x

         x = \displaystyle \frac{y}{1.5}

Ilang metro ang 1300 sentimetro?<br><br>a. 1metro<br>b. 13 metro<br>c. 130 metro​
Pie

Answer:

1300 cm = 13 m

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to find meters in 1300 cm.

We know that,

1 m = 100 cm

1 cm = (1/100) m

It means,

1300\ cm=\dfrac{1300}{100}\ m\\\\=13\ m

Hence, there are 13 m in 1300 cm.
